About The Course

Certificate in Working in Confined Spaces

Course Duration: 29 minutes (approx.)

Employers have a legal duty to ensure that those who undertake work in a confined space have adequate training to do so. In a wide range of industries, many people in the UK are killed or seriously injured as a result of working in confined spaces or due to a lack of adequate training when attempting to rescue others.

This essential CPD course provides you with the core content you need to know in relation to working in confined spaces, including identifying risks and performing risk assessments.

Split into bite-sized modules, the training has been designed to provide maximum learning potential in the leanest, most cost-effective and most time-efficient manner. It has been produced in high-quality remote video CPD format which is accessible on any device, any time, anywhere.

Delivered by chartered health and safety expert, James Whelan, this course is split into three modules with a knowledge assessment at the end to help you evidence your learning.

Designed in line with the following policies:

  • Confined Space Regulations 1997
  • Health & Safety at Work etc. Act 1974

Learning Objectives:

  • Understanding what is meant by and how to identify a confined space and the common risks associated with working in different environments.
  • Understanding legal requirements around working in confined spaces and the responsibilities of employers.
  • Recognising how and when to conduct a risk assessment and who should complete it.
  • Identifying safe systems of work and the importance of using a detailed risk assessment to guide the necessary safey measures that should be employed.
  • Recognising how to implement effective emergency procedures and the type of training individuals need in order to undertake an emergency rescue.

Course Units

Introduction

Delivered by chartered health and safety expert, James Whelan, this course is split into three modules with a knowledge assessment at the end to help you evidence your learning.

Module 1: The dangers of confined spaces

This module will explore the definition of a confined space, provide typical examples and discuss the associated risks with working in these areas.

Module 2: Legislation and risk assessments

This module will cover key aspects of the legislation surrounding working in confined spaces, including the need to carry out a sufficiently detailed risk assessment.

Module 3: Safe systems of work for confined spaces

This module explains safe systems of work for confined spaces and the central role risk assessments play in identifying the precautions needed to reduce the risk of injury.
